PVAc改性酚醛树脂制备铝木复合材料研究  被引量:7

PF Adhesive Modified by PVAc for Manufacturing Technology of Decorative Fiberboard with Aluminum Foils

摘  要:以PVAc改性酚醛树脂作为胶粘剂热压制备铝箔贴面人造板,采用正交试验研究热压温度、热压时间、热压压力和施胶量对板材物理力学性能的影响。结果表明:热压温度对产品的各项性能指标影响最显著,其次为热压时间;最佳热压工艺条件为:热压温度140℃,热压时间9min,热压压力0.6MPa,施胶量200g·m-2。Modified phenolic resin was used to manufacture decorative fiberboard with aluminum foils by hot-pressing technology. An orthogonal experiment was designed to optimize the process parameters: hot- pressing temperature and time,unit pressure and glue content. The results showed that hot-pressing tem- perature had the most significant influence on quality indice of the product, followed by hot-pressing time. The optimal technological parameters were hot-pressing temperature 140℃ , hot pressing time 9 rain, unit pressure 0.6 MPa,glue content 200 g . m -2.
